All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Macros Groups Pages
icarus::opdet::CustomPulseFunction< T > Member List

This is the complete list of members for icarus::opdet::CustomPulseFunction< T >, including all inherited members.

ADCcount typedeficarus::opdet::CustomPulseFunction< T >
Base_t typedeficarus::opdet::CustomPulseFunction< T >private
baseline() const icarus::opdet::PhotoelectronPulseFunction< T >inline
checkExcessParameters(TFormula const &formula, PulseParameters_t const &parameters)icarus::opdet::CustomPulseFunction< T >privatestatic
checkMissingParameters(TFormula const &formula, PulseParameters_t const &parameters)icarus::opdet::CustomPulseFunction< T >privatestatic
CustomPulseFunction(std::string const &expression, PulseParameters_t const &parameters, Time peakTime)icarus::opdet::CustomPulseFunction< T >
CustomPulseFunction(std::string const &expression, PulseParameters_t const &parameters, std::string const &peakTime)icarus::opdet::CustomPulseFunction< T >
CustomPulseFunction(std::string const &expression, PulseParameters_t const &parameters)icarus::opdet::CustomPulseFunction< T >private
doBaseline() const icarus::opdet::PhotoelectronPulseFunction< T >inlineprotectedvirtual
doDump(std::ostream &out, std::string const &indent, std::string const &firstIndent) const overrideicarus::opdet::CustomPulseFunction< T >privatevirtual
doEvaluateAt(Time time) const overrideicarus::opdet::CustomPulseFunction< T >inlineprivatevirtual
icarus::opdet::PhotoelectronPulseFunction::doEvaluateAt(Time time) const =0icarus::opdet::PhotoelectronPulseFunction< T >protectedpure virtual
doPeakAmplitude() const overrideicarus::opdet::CustomPulseFunction< T >inlineprivatevirtual
doPeakTime() const overrideicarus::opdet::CustomPulseFunction< T >inlineprivatevirtual
doPolarity() const icarus::opdet::PhotoelectronPulseFunction< T >inlineprotectedvirtual
dump(std::ostream &out, std::string const &indent, std::string const &firstIndent) const icarus::opdet::PhotoelectronPulseFunction< T >inline
dump(std::ostream &&out, std::string const &indent="") const icarus::opdet::PhotoelectronPulseFunction< T >inline
evaluateAt(Time time) const icarus::opdet::PhotoelectronPulseFunction< T >inline
extractStats(Time peakTime) const icarus::opdet::CustomPulseFunction< T >private
fFormulaicarus::opdet::CustomPulseFunction< T >private
fStatsicarus::opdet::CustomPulseFunction< T >private
NameAndValue_t typedeficarus::opdet::CustomPulseFunction< T >
operator()(Time time) const icarus::opdet::PhotoelectronPulseFunction< T >inline
parameter(std::string const &name) const icarus::opdet::CustomPulseFunction< T >
ParameterValue_t typedeficarus::opdet::CustomPulseFunction< T >
peakAmplitude() const icarus::opdet::PhotoelectronPulseFunction< T >inline
peakTime() const icarus::opdet::PhotoelectronPulseFunction< T >inline
polarity() const icarus::opdet::PhotoelectronPulseFunction< T >inline
PulseParameters_t typedeficarus::opdet::CustomPulseFunction< T >
setParameters(TFormula &formula, PulseParameters_t const &parameters)icarus::opdet::CustomPulseFunction< T >privatestatic
Time typedeficarus::opdet::CustomPulseFunction< T >
toString(std::string const &indent, std::string const &firstIndent) const icarus::opdet::PhotoelectronPulseFunction< T >
toString(std::string const &indent="") const icarus::opdet::PhotoelectronPulseFunction< T >inline
~PhotoelectronPulseFunction()=defaulticarus::opdet::PhotoelectronPulseFunction< T >virtual